Output 7a66a801cb08a68efbb3db40b20e81bffcd32d1a351c3f3a291b73bb36015fef:1

value
1758209
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2588b4c49881ffbc4f8e0c8a915a43bc772d4fae OP_EQUALVERIFY OP_CHECKSIG
address
14RTmc8uNbmQXUVWcDeSv3XgkQcSGvzFHn
transaction
7a66a801cb08a68efbb3db40b20e81bffcd32d1a351c3f3a291b73bb36015fef
spent
true